missingWrote a review on May 24
Perfect location in the city centre, close to plenty of restaurants and shops. the antique China and cutlery at breakfast were exquisite. the large rooms and bathrooms were impressive.
The hotel is a bit dated, and there could be better instructions on where to park. It was confusing getting near the property by car due to one-way systems and traffic limitations, but it was manageable with a parking pass.

missingWrote a review on Dec 30
Review:
the location was ideal for exploring the town's atmosphere and attractions. My room had antique furniture, a comfortable bed, and modern bathroom. the service was friendly and helpful, and breakfast was a delight with a good selection of food. Although the hotel had no parking on site, I was provided a ZLT pass for nearby street parking. the soundproofing in the room could have been better.
